Home Control International Stock Based Compensation Calculation

Stock Based Compensation is a way corporations use stock options to reward employees. It provides executives and employees the opportunity to share in the growth of the company and, if structured properly, can align their interests with the interests of the company's shareholders and investors, without burning the company's cash on hand.

Home Control International Business Description

Address 1 Paya Lebar Link, PLQ1 No. 04-01, Office 448, New Tech Park, Singapore, SGP, 408533
Home Control International Ltd is an investment holding company. The Company and its subsidiaries are principally engaged in the provision of solutions for sensing and control technologies marketed in the smart home automation, consumer electronics, and set-top-box segments. Geographically, it derives a majority of its revenue from Europe and also has a presence in North America, Asia, and Latin America.
